Definition of backmap - Reverso English Dictionary
Verb
1.
investigationTECH. trace back to original sourceTECH.
- Scientists backmapped the virus to its origin.
2.
cartographyTECH. create a map from existing dataTECH.
- The team will backmap the area using satellite images.
Origin of backmap
English, back (rear) + map (chart)
Examples of backmap in a sentence
Researchers backmapped the data to find the source. They plan to backmap the region using old charts. Researchers will backmap the forest from drone footage.
